本繁體中文版使用機器翻譯,譯文僅供參考,若與英文版本牴觸,應以英文版本為準。
將BeeGFS服務對應至檔案節點
貢獻者
建議變更
使用指定可以執行每個BeeGFS服務的檔案節點 inventory.yml
檔案:
總覽
本節將逐步說明如何建立 inventory.yml
檔案:這包括列出所有區塊節點、並指定可執行每個BeeGFS服務的檔案節點。
步驟
建立檔案 inventory.yml
並填入如下內容:
-
從檔案頂端建立標準的可Ansible庫存結構:
# BeeGFS HA (High_Availability) cluster inventory. all: children:
-
建立一個群組、其中包含參與此HA叢集的所有區塊節點:
# Ansible group representing all block nodes: eseries_storage_systems: hosts: <BLOCK NODE HOSTNAME>: <BLOCK NODE HOSTNAME>: # Additional block nodes as needed.
-
建立一個群組、其中包含叢集中的所有BeeGFS服務、以及執行這些服務的檔案節點:
# Ansible group representing all file nodes: ha_cluster: children:
-
針對叢集中的每個BeeGFS服務、定義應該執行該服務的慣用和任何次要檔案節點:
<SERVICE>: # Ex. "mgmt", "meta_01", or "stor_01". hosts: <FILE NODE HOSTNAME>: <FILE NODE HOSTNAME>: # Additional file nodes as needed.
按一下 "請按這裡" 以取得完整庫存檔案的範例。